在谷歌浏览器中利用开发者工具进行网页调试
在当今互联网时代,网页设计与开发变得日益重要。无论你是一名前端开发者,还是只是在学习网页创建和设计,掌握开发者工具都是不可或缺的一环。谷歌浏览器(Google Chrome)自带的开发者工具(DevTools)是一个功能强大的调试工具,用户可以利用它轻松地分析和修改网页内容。本文将介绍如何在谷歌浏览器中使用开发者工具进行有效的网页调试。
首先,打开谷歌浏览器并访问你想要调试的网页。要进入开发者工具,你可以右键点击网页的任意位置,然后选择“检查”选项,或者直接按快捷键 Ctrl+Shift+I(Windows)或 Command+Option+I(Mac)。这将打开一个分屏,左边是网页的 DOM 结构和 CSS 样式,右边是控制台和其他详细信息。
开发者工具的主要功能模块包括元素、控制台、网络、性能等。我们首先来看看“元素”标签。在这个标签下,你可以查看网页的 HTML 结构以及每个元素的 CSS 样式。选中网页中的某个元素,你会在右侧的面板中看到该元素的详细属性。这不仅可以帮助你快速找到想要修改的部分,例如调整字体、颜色或尺寸,还能实时预览修改效果,无需刷新网页。
接下来是“控制台”标签。控制台不仅可以用于查看网页的 JavaScript 错误,还可以直接输入和执行 JavaScript 代码。这对于开发者调试和测试特定功能至关重要。你可以通过输人JavaScript代码,快速测试函数的运行情况或查看变量的值,极大地提高了开发效率。
网络标签是另一个非常实用的功能,尤其是在分析网页加载性能时。在这个标签下,用户可以查看所有网络请求,包括图片、脚本、样式表等文件的加载时间和状态。通过分析这些信息,可以判断某些资源是否过大,从而影响网页的加载速度。你还可以查看请求的响应时间、数据大小和状态码,这对于排查404错误或其他问题非常有效。
性能标签则用于监测网页加载的性能指标。你可以通过录制网页性能,分析每个元素的加载时间,找出瓶颈所在。性能分析对提升用户体验和优化网页加载速度至关重要。
最后,不得不提的是“应用程序”标签。在这里,你可以查看和管理网页的存储,例如 cookies、localStorage 和 sessionStorage。这些信息对调试需要长期存储状态的应用非常有用,便于查看和修改存储的值以及确保应用数据的一致性。
总结来说,谷歌浏览器的开发者工具是一个强大的网页调试工具,能够帮助开发者和设计师更高效地进行网页开发。通过元素、控制台、网络、性能等模块的使用,用户可以深入了解网页的构建与运行状态,从而及时对问题进行修正和优化。无论你处于学习阶段还是已经进入工作领域,熟练掌握开发者工具都是提升你网页开发技能的关键。